MUS 112 - 20th Century Music


Important musicians and musical styles of the 20th century.  Emphasis on the trends and development of music in America.  Leading European composers.

Prerequisite- Corequisite
Prerequisite:  MUS 101 Introduction to Music or consent of instructor

Credits: 3
Hours
3 Class Hours
Course Profile
Learning Outcomes of the Course:

Upon successful completion of this course the student will be able to:

1.  Describe the transition out of a Romanticism-based aesthetic into a wider range of styles and motivations.
2.  Identify important composers, and the aesthetic point of view they illustrate.
3.  Identify representative compositions and the stylistic movements they exemplify.
